Nestled at the heart of artistic Carbondale, this Historic Victorian home is the perfect vacation rental for anyone who loves small-town ambiance with big mountain adventures. After you sip your morning coffee in the 2 bed, 1.5 bath abode, it’s time to step out onto Main Street to enjoy nationally renowned cuisine, a vibrant art scene, live music, and community celebrations. The scenic Rio Grande Trail, Marble Distillery, and the True Nature Yoga center can be found right outside your doorstep! -- THE PROPERTY -- Historic Victorian Charm | Close to Downtown Shops, Coffee & Dining | Free WiFi Packed with charming decor, luxurious touches, and essential amenities, this Carbondale retreat is perfect for travelers seeking a picturesque mountain getaway and ample opportunities for outdoor adventure with downtown conveniences! Bedroom 1: Queen Bed | Bedroom 2: Queen Bed | Living Room: Twin Daybed OUTDOOR SPACE: Large private yard w/ shade trees, gas grill, patio furniture, outdoor dining, 3 cruiser bikes (summer only) INDOOR LIVING: Flat-screen TV, breakfast nook & sunroom, laptop workstations, jetted tub w/ marble steam shower, books, board games KITCHEN: Fully equipped w/ cooking & baking essentials, stainless steel appliances, dishware/flatware, drip coffee maker, Crock-Pot, kettle, toaster oven, full knife set GENERAL: Washer/dryer, linens/towels, complimentary toiletries, central air conditioning/heat, hair dryer, iron/board FAQ: Step-free access, single-story home, grab rails in shower/tub PARKING: Gravel driveway (2 vehicles), free street parking -- THE LOCATION -- AREA ACTIVITIES: Gold Medal Fly-fishing, World-class skiing of Aspen (4 mountains), river rafting, kayaking, cross-country skiing, hiking, mountain biking, climbing LOCAL MUST DOS: Marble Distillery (150 feet), True Nature Yoga & Healing Arts Center (528 feet), Crystal Movie Theatre (0.2 miles), Golf @ River Valley Ranch (1.0 mile), Red Hill & Mushroom Rock Recreation Area (1.3 miles), Avalanche Hotsprings (11.0 miles), Historic Redstone Castle (16.0 miles), Glenwood Caverns Adventure Park (13.8 miles), Iconic Maroon Bells Wilderness Area (37.0 miles) SKI RESORTS: Spring Gulch Nordic Trail System (7.5 miles) Sunlight Mountain Resort (22.6 miles), Aspen Ski Resorts- Buttermilk (Beginner - 27.0 miles), Snowmass (Family-Friendly- 30.0 miles) Aspen Highlands (29.0 miles) & Aspen Mountain (Intermediate & Advanced - 30.0 miles) NEARBY TOWNS: Basalt (8.3 miles), Glenwood Springs (13.5 miles), New Castle (26.0 miles), Aspen (29.2 miles) AIRPORTS: Pitkin County Aspen Airport (26.0 miles), Eagle County Regional Airport (40.6 miles), Denver International Airport (200 miles) -- REST EASY WITH US -- Evolve makes it easy to find and book properties you’ll never want to leave.
